How the property tax calculator works
Property purchases in the UK attract a transaction tax that differs by nation: Stamp Duty Land Tax (SDLT) in England and Northern Ireland, Land and Buildings Transaction Tax (LBTT) in Scotland, and Land Transaction Tax (LTT) in Wales. This calculator estimates the tax due based on the purchase price and buyer type.
It accounts for the higher rates on additional properties (second homes and buy-to-lets) and, where relevant, first-time buyer relief. The rules change from time to time, so treat the result as an estimate and confirm the position before you exchange.

Which tax applies to my purchase?+
It depends on where the property is: SDLT in England & Northern Ireland, LBTT in Scotland, LTT in Wales. The calculator applies the right one when you select the nation.
Do I pay the higher rate?+
The additional-property surcharge applies if, at the end of the transaction, you own more than one residential property and are not replacing your main home. The calculator includes this where you indicate it.
